Bromination of indomethacin

A. V. Ivachtchenkoab, P. M. Yamanushkina, O. D. Mitkina, O. I. Kiselevc

a Department of Organic Chemistry, Chemical Diversity Research Institute, Khimki, Moscow Region, Russian Federation
b ChemDiv Inc., San Diego, CA, USA
c A.A. Smorodintsev Research Institute of Influenza, St. Petersburg, Russian Federation
Abstract: Treatment of indomethacin with N-bromosuccinimide in AcOH results in bromination in aromatic positions 4 and 6, while the use of tetrachloromethane allows ultimate bromination at the C(2) Me group of the indole moiety to proceed.
